The problem with some of these units is they might “work” as far fuel economy is concerned but also increase nitrogen oxide (NOx), a big no-no for a production, EPA certified vehicle.
A “private” person might not care...
Please do any tune ups of the engine prior to adding the hydrogen generators. Then run it for a while and get a good gas mileage figure for comparison.
One of the scams is to take a car, badly in need of a tune-up, install some worthless equipment and perform a tune-up, and claim the results as from the equipment.
Be extremely skeptical and cautious. I have a $200,000 engine dyno (I make airplane engines). I have tested Browns gas, it lowers the octane rating which retards the timing, not a good thing. If you accidently rev the engine you will destroy it. I have gotten good at destroying engines, lots of practice : )
What I have observed is that people who use these devices alter their driving behavior and tune up their vehicles. It is very easy to get better gas mileage simply by idling less, driving a little bit slower, not accelerating as quikly, etc. My dodge Cummins diesel pickup gets between 15 and 25 mpg depending on how I drive it. I think that driving into the wind as opposed to driving with the wind makes about a 2 mpg (10%) difference.
The bottom line is that gasoline is a very good fuel. Changing the composition by adding hydrogen and/or oxygen in any form has very marginal benefits, and a lot of potential bad effects. An engine is just a pump designed to run very close to the stoichiometric point, if you change the composition of the fuel too much be prepared to replace the engine.
I talk to these snake oil salesmen occasionally and I find the silence very telling when I tell them I would like to test their product on a dyno. More often than not, that is the end of the conversation, they lose interest in selling me the product instantaneously.
